Faial Da Terra offers a good selection of easy hiking trails, with 15 routes specifically categorized as easy. In total, there are over 70 hiking routes available in the area, catering to various skill levels.
Easy hikes in Faial Da Terra immerse you in a landscape shaped by volcanic activity, featuring lush, dense forests, numerous streams, and dramatic coastal views. You'll often find paths winding through endemic Azorean vegetation and leading past charming old villages.
Yes, several easy trails lead to stunning waterfalls. For instance, the Enchanted Forest Trail – Small Waterfalls loop from Ribeira Quente offers a chance to see cascades. The region is known for its impressive waterfalls like the Prego Waterfall and Salto do Cagarrão, which are often part of popular routes.
Absolutely. Many of the easy trails in Faial Da Terra are designed as circular routes, allowing you to start and end at the same point. An example is the Água Retorta — circular route on the Island of São Miguel (PRC 13 SMI), which takes you through verdant forests.
Beyond the lush forests and waterfalls, you can explore unique natural features and historical sites. The Furnas Lake – Furnas Caldeiras (Hot Springs) loop from Furnas takes you past the beautiful Furnas Lake and its famous hot springs. You might also encounter the abandoned Sanguinho village, offering a glimpse into the region's past.
Yes, Faial Da Terra's dramatic coastline is a highlight of many easy trails. The Nordeste - Arnel Lighthouse Trail, for example, provides stunning coastal vistas and leads towards the historic Arnel Lighthouse.

While public transport options exist on São Miguel, they can be limited, especially to more remote trailheads. It's advisable to check local bus schedules or consider renting a car for greater flexibility when planning to access easy hiking routes around Faial Da Terra.
Parking is generally available near the starting points of popular trails in Faial Da Terra, often in or near the main villages. However, spaces can be limited during peak season, so arriving early is recommended. Always look for designated parking areas.
The Azores generally have a mild climate year-round. However, the spring and summer months (April to October) offer the most pleasant weather for hiking, with warmer temperatures and less rainfall, making it ideal for enjoying the lush landscapes and waterfalls on easy trails.
Yes, the volcanic nature of the region means there are thermal attractions nearby. The Furnas Lake – Furnas Caldeiras (Hot Springs) loop from Furnas is an easy route that brings you close to the famous Furnas hot springs. You can also visit the Terra Nostra Thermal Pool or Poça da Dona Beija Hot Springs for a relaxing experience after your hike.
